    What is Dr. Alan Weintraub's specialty?

    Dr. Weintraub is a Gastroenterologist near Tampa, FL. An internist focused on diagnosing and treating disorders of the digestive system, encompassing the stomach, intestines, liver, and gallbladder. This specialist manages conditions like abdominal pain, ulcers, diarrhea, cancer, and jaundice, and performs intricate diagnostic and therapeutic procedures using endoscopes to examine internal organs.
